7 Stocks you need to know for Thursday

An uncertain Fed combined with an improved number from the service sector resulted in a lackluster mixed trading session. The Institute for Supply Management (ISM) index broke above 50, signaling expansion. However, lack of clear direction at the Federal Reserve deflated the bullish posture. The DJIA eased higher by 1.66, the Nasdaq gave back 7.62, and the S&P 500 gained 0.62.
